15. diel - Štandardy jazyka PHP - PSR-11 (Vkladanie závislosťou)
V minulej lekcii, Štandardy jazyka PHP - PSR-7 (Rozhranie HTTP odpovedí) , sme si ukázali rozhrania
ResponseInterface
a UploadedFilesInterface
a ukončili
tak sériu o štandarde PSR-7.
PSR-11 je ďalší štandard jazyka PHP a týka sa vkladanie závislostí
(anglicky dependency
injection, skrátene tiež DI) a vytváranie DI kontajnerov.
Popisuje rozhranie pre prácu s týmito kontajnermi. Účelom štandardu (a
rozhranie ContainerInterface
) je znormalizovať používanie DI
kontajnerov a ich vstupov (entries).
Pojmom implementátor, ktorý budeme v článku používať, rozumieme niekoho
...koniec náhľadu článku...
Pokračuj ďalej
Minul si až sem a to je super! Veríme, že ti prvé lekcie ukázali niečo nového a užitočného.
Chceš v kurze pokračovať? Prejdi do prémiové sekcie.
Kúpiť tento kurz
Obsah článku spadá pod licenciu Premium, kúpou článku súhlasíš so zmluvnými podmienkami.
- Neobmedzený a trvalý prístup k jednotlivým lekciím.
- Kvalitné znalosti v oblasti IT.
- Zručnosti, ktoré ti pomôžu získať vysnívanú a dobre platenú prácu.
Popis článku
Požadovaný článok má nasledujúci obsah:
Štandard PSR-11 jazyka PHP. Popisuje vkladanie závislostí, kontajnery, základné výnimky a rozhranie pre prácu s nimi.
Kredity získaš, keď podporíš našu sieť. To môžeš urobiť buď zaslaním symbolickej sumy na podporu prevádzky alebo pridaním obsahu na sieť.